    進一步引導學生思考利用數(shù)學知識可寫成等式F=kma學生很自然就會思考比列系數(shù)K應該是多少?通過教師引導學生舉例各國長度單位不同(如英國:英里、碼、英尺、英寸;中國:市里、市丈、市尺、市寸、市分 )導致交流不便。為了適應各國交流需要國際計量局規(guī)定了一套統(tǒng)一的單位,稱為國際單位制 。取不同的單位制K是不同的,為了簡潔方便,在選取了質量和加速度的國際單位(Kg, m/s2)時規(guī)定K=1。那么就有;F=ma為了紀念牛頓,就把能使1kg物體獲得1m/s2加速度的力稱做一牛頓,用符號N表示問題:實際物體受力往往不止一個,多個力情況應該怎么辦呢?平行四邊形法則進一步引導學生得出牛頓第二定律更一般的表達式: F合=ma思考.討論我們用力提一個很重的箱子,卻提不動它。這個力產生了加速度嗎?要是產生了,箱子的運動狀態(tài)卻并沒有改變。為什么?

    研究一種物理現(xiàn)象,總是要先從現(xiàn)象的描述入手。機械運動作為自然界最簡單和最基本的運動形態(tài),它所描述的是物體空間位置隨時間變化的情況。因此,本節(jié)學習描述質點做機械運動需要時刻、時間間隔和位移等概念。相當一部分高一學生在具體過程中難以區(qū)別時刻和時間間隔。另外,由于思維的定式,在第一次接觸既要考慮大小又要考慮方向的問題時,會因不適應造成學習困難。所以,區(qū)別“路程與位移”“時刻和時間間隔”是教學的重難點所在。學習這些內容的過程與方法對學習速度和加速度可以起到奠定基礎的作用。教學的對象是高一的學生,這一時期的學生處在好奇善問、創(chuàng)新意識強烈的青少年期。對于生活中出現(xiàn)的各種現(xiàn)象具有濃厚的興趣。但他們的思維還停留在簡單的代數(shù)運算階段,對于矢量和矢量運算的理性認識幾乎沒有。且對生活中出現(xiàn)的時間、時刻、時間間隔等不能做出很好的區(qū)分,對時常提及的路程、距離等形成了模糊的前概念。

    二、程朱理學:1、宋代“理學”的產生:(1)含義:所謂“理學”,就是用“理學”一詞來指明當時兩宋時期所呈現(xiàn)出來的儒學。廣義的理學,泛指以討論天道問題為中心的整個哲學思潮,包括各種不同的學派;狹義的理學,專指程顥、程頤、朱熹為代表的,以“理”為最高范疇的學說,稱為“程朱理學”。理學是北宋政治、社會、經濟發(fā)展的理論表現(xiàn),是中國古代哲學長期發(fā)展的結果,是批判佛、道學說的產物。他們把“理”或“天理”視作哲學的最高范疇,認為理無所不在,不生不滅,不僅是世界的本原,也是社會生活的最高準則。在窮理方法上,程顥“主靜”,強調“正心誠意”;程頤“主敬”,強調“格物致知”。在人性論上,二程主張“去人欲,存天理”,并深入闡釋這一觀點使之更加系統(tǒng)化。二程學說的出現(xiàn),標志著宋代“理學”思想體系的正式形成。【合作探究】宋代“理學”興起的社會條件:
